How This Service Actually Works
Emergency Water Extraction isn’t just about sucking up water. It’s about using the right tools, the right techniques, and the right timing. We start by removing standing water with powerful pumps. Then we use industrial air movers and dehumidifiers to dry out the area. We check moisture levels with devices that measure humidity and water content. We do this step by step, making sure everything is dry before we move on. A rushed job can lead to mold, structural damage, and more costs. We do it right the first time.

Emergency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small puddle on the floor | Yes | No | It’s easy to clean up, but you need to check for hidden moisture. A small problem can turn into a big one. |
| Standing water in the basement | No | Yes | It’s too much for a DIY approach. You need professional equipment to remove it quickly and safely. |
| Water damage in walls or under floors | No | Yes | It’s hidden and hard to reach. You need the right tools to find and remove it. |
| Water from a flood | No | Yes | A flood can cause serious damage. You need fast, professional help to prevent more issues. |
| Water damage that’s been there for days | No | Yes | It’s too late for a DIY fix. You need expert help to dry everything out properly. |
| Water damage that’s causing mold | No | Yes | Mold is dangerous. You need professional help to remove it safely and completely. |

Emergency Water Extraction Cost In Madison, VA
Emergency Water Extraction costs vary depending on the size of the job, the type of water, and how long it’s been there. You can expect to pay between $500 and $2,500 for basic water removal. More complex jobs can cost more. You don’t want to let it get worse. You don’t want to pay more. You need to act fast. You need to get help now.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water, how long it’s been there, and the area affected. |
| Drying Equipment Setup | $300 – $1,000 | Size of the space and number of machines needed. |
| Moisture Testing | $100 – $300 | Number of tests and areas checked. |
| Mold Removal |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of the mold and area affected. |
| Structural Drying | $800 – $3,000 | Size of the space and type of materials used. |
| Final Inspection | $100 – $200 | Scope of the final check and number of areas tested. |
